Prep Time:20 mins
Cook Time:15 mins
Total Time:35 mins
Servings: 8

Ingredients

  • 100 grams gluten-free flour blend
  • 30 grams tapioca starch
  • 1 teaspoon xanthan gum
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 0.25 teaspoon salt
  • 50 grams coconut oil
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 150 grams homemade Nutella
  • 50 grams chopped hazelnuts

Directions

Step 1

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.

Step 2

In a large bowl, whisk together the gluten-free flour blend, tapioca starch, xanthan gum, sugar, and salt until well combined.

Step 3

Add the coconut oil, egg, and vanilla extract to the flour mixture. Mix until a smooth dough forms.

Step 4

On a lightly floured surface, roll out the dough until it's about 1/8 inch thick.

Step 5

Cut the rolled out dough into small rectangles (approximately 5x10 cm).

Step 6

Place a teaspoon of homemade Nutella in the center of each rectangle and sprinkle with some chopped hazelnuts.

Step 7

Fold the dough over the Nutella, pressing the edges tightly to seal, creating a small envelope.

Step 8

Carefully place the dough envelopes on the prepared baking sheet.

Step 9

Bake in the preheated oven for 12-15 minutes until they start to turn golden brown.

Step 10

Remove from the oven and let them c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.

Step 11

Serve these delightful gluten-free treats at room temperature or slightly warmed. Enjoy!
